Output 36ed23f668e5ef19be146f53e9469e57c7e3ba66fd4640efa05ea6c17f164f63:10

value
636995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9bed8315e1fc5d4e6875630587ae71e43d01392 OP_EQUAL
address
3Jd9Z98Mr821jD37rzQjC12Z8w8fAt2WTy
transaction
36ed23f668e5ef19be146f53e9469e57c7e3ba66fd4640efa05ea6c17f164f63
spent
true